Output ebc03897d4910b7e3b092590aad8fca4442bd031026fef1e28484ae7de9d9b35:2

value
18756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ad569fc0d765ee75865081c119bf4d4b87aea683 OP_EQUAL
address
3HVYbUShPTmP6S5hdAXVgjKPLMjzpJwNZ7
transaction
ebc03897d4910b7e3b092590aad8fca4442bd031026fef1e28484ae7de9d9b35
confirmations
167991
spent
true